This is an RC-scale front steering blocks set produced by JAZRIDER for Traxxas 1/18 TRX4M platforms, supplied in a black finish with brass as the working material. The parts replace the standard front steering blocks on TRX4M Bronco and TRX-4M Defender 1/18 models and are intended for hobby use on scale trail crawlers.
Brass steering blocks change how the front axle behaves by adding mass and using a metal contact surface where the stock plastic parts normally sit. In practice this improves long-term wear resistance at pivot points and alters steering feedback, which can help drivers tuning front-end balance and steering effort on scaled trails.
Installation is straightforward for experienced hobbyists: the blocks are designed as direct-fit replacements for the specified 1/18 TRX4M Bronco and TRX-4M Defender steering knuckles and typically reuse the factory screws and hardware. After fitting, verify steering geometry and wheel alignment, and check that the pivot points move freely without binding.
Tuning notes: because brass adds rotating and unsprung mass at the front, expect slightly heavier steering feel and a different settling behaviour on rocky or uneven surfaces. Use this part as a component in a broader tuning approach—adjust tyre choice, suspension preload and servo endpoints to match the new front-end characteristics.
